2025 Board of Directors Election Nominees
Election Slate:
- First Vice President (will ascend to 2028 President): Andrew McGranaghan vs. Patti Whalen
- Commercial Director (three-year term): Louise Frazier (unopposed)
- General Director (three-year term): Pat McGill (unopposed)
- General Director (three-year term): Rachel Wright (unopposed)
- General Director (two-year term): Katie Beeler (unopposed)
Vice President
Patti Whalen

First Vice President Candidate Patti Whalen is a broker/owner of EXIT TLC Realty and co-owner of EXIT Realty Pros TN. She holds the ABR, AHWD, CRB, e-pro, MRP, PMN, PSA, RENE, SFR, SRES, SRC and C2EX designations and certifications. Patti is a member of WCR, RRC, REBI, CRE and CRS. Over the years she has served on ETNR committees including Grievance and Professional Standards. Patti has served two terms on the ETNR Board of Directors as Loudon County Chapter chair.
At the state level, Patti has served for several years on TREEF and is currently serving as TREEF's president. Patti is a strong advocate for RPAC and achieved Hall of Fame status. She has served several years as a TR director. Outside of real estate, Patti is a member of HBAGK and the Loudon County Chamber of Commerce. She is a graduate of Leadership Loudon.
Patti is seeking the position “due to my desire and passion to serve for the greater good of ETNR and its members.”
Andrew McGranaghan

First Vice President Candidate Andrew McGranaghan is the chief development officer and partner of Wallace Real Estate. He currently serves as a general director on the ETNR Board of Directors. Over the years, Andrew has served on ETNR committees and task forces including Public Policy, Governmental Affairs, Grievance and multiple election candidate task forces.
At the state level, Andrew has served two years on the Public Policy committee. Andrew is a strong advocate for RPAC and is a regular major investor. He has served several years as TR director. Outside of real estate, he is a graduate of Leadership Knoxville. He is a multi-year member of Nucleus, United Way Ambassador, Knoxville Fellows program mentor and a Susannah’s House volunteer.
Andrew is seeking the position because he believes “we are at a pivotal crossroads that demands strong, creative leadership.”
Commercial Director
Louise Frazier

Commercial Director Candidate Louise Frazier is the broker/founder of Blue Ridge Realty, Inc. overseeing leasing, sales and property management for various commercial properties. She currently is in her second year as chair of the ETNR Commercial Committee. Over the years, Louise has served on numerous committees, task forces and presidential advisory groups, including the Nominating Committee and Bylaws Advisory Group. She is a regular RPAC investor.
Louise’s other recognitions and awards:
- CCIM member since 1996, including CCIM Deal of the Year (2010), CCIM Office Broker of the Year (2015), and East Tennessee Chapter CCIM President (1999 and 2015)
- SIOR member since 2015
- IREM member since 1992
- The Development Corporation of Knox County, board member
- University of Tennessee Chancellor’s Associates, 2020 chair
- CoStar Impact Award, 2022 Lease of the Year Warner Bros. Discovery.
Outside of commercial real estate, Louise is an active supporter of several nonprofits and currently serves on the Girl Talk, Inc. Board of Directors. She is a Leadership Knoxville graduate.
Louise is seeking the position “to represent fellow commercial Realtors in key decisions and to help shape policy and practices that affect the local market.”
General Director (two-year term)
Katie Beeler

General Director Candidate Katie Beeler is a Realtor and Property Manager with LeConte Realty, LLC. She holds the ABR, Green, GRI, MRP, PSA and RENE designations. Katie is a 2023 Leadership KAAR graduate and served on the Community Involvement committee.
At the state level, Katie has served on the Grievance committee and is currently the committee’s vice chair. She is a 2025 A.R.E.A. class member and will graduate from the program this fall. She is a regular RPAC investor.
Outside of real estate, Katie is a Leadership Blount graduate, Maryville Kiwanis board member and is active with New Hope Children’s Advocacy Center and the LeConte Realty Foundation. Katie is seeking the position because she “cares deeply about the industry, the agents who make it work and the communities we serve.”
General Director (three-year term)
Pat McGill

General Director Candidate Pat McGill is a principal broker/co-owner of Realty Executives Associates. She holds the GRI, ABR and CRB designations. Currently, she serves on the ETNR Benevolent Fund Board of Directors. Over the years, Pat has been active with ETNR, including serving on the Board of Directors in 2014, the MLS Committee and as the Blount County Chapter chair. She was secretary and president of the Blount County Association of Realtors. Pat is a RPAC advocate and served as 2024 RPAC Chair, successfully leading the association to reach its goals for the first time ever!
Outside of real estate, Pat is active in her community and has served on numerous community and civic organizations, including leadership roles. Currently she serves as a director for the Blount Partnership/Chamber of Commerce and board member of Blount County Youth Court. She is a member of the United Way Pillars Society. Pat graduated from Leadership Blount in 2013.
Pat is seeking the position because she believes “our industry is looking at big changes in how we do business. I believe in the integrity of this profession and want to see it flourish.”
General Director (three-year term)
Rachel Wright

General Director Candidate Rachel Wright is the principal broker of Noble Realty. She holds the ABR and SRS designations. In addition, she holds membership in the Real Estate Business Institute and the Real Estate Buyer’s Agent Council. She is the current MLS Committee chair. Rachel is a Leadership KAAR graduate and has served on numerous ETNR committees and task forces, including the scholarship selection task force and multiple MLS Presidential Advisory Groups. Currently, as approved by the Board of Directors, she is completing a half-year term on the directorate created when Director Jessica Catapano relocated out of state. Rachel is a regular RPAC investor.
Outside of real estate, Rachel serves on the Carrie On Events board of directors as its sponsorship liaison. She owns several businesses and properties in the South Knoxville community. Rachel is seeking the position because she “believes in giving back to an industry that has given so much to her and to foster a community where every member can thrive.”
